The SIG Sauer P320 AXG Scorpion is making waves as the first commercially available metal P320 and as the brand's first pistol release from SIG Custom Works. This handgun is chambered in 9mm Luger and marries the weight and balance of a metal-framed pistol with the performance and reliability the P320 is known for.  The edgy desert-inspired aesthetic doesn't hurt either.
